(1):

(a.) Of or pertaining to atra bilis or black bile, a fluid formerly supposed to be produced by the kidneys.

(2):

(a.) Melancholic or hypohondriac; atrabilious; - from the supposed predominance of black bile, to the influence of which the ancients attributed hypochondria, melancholy, and mania.
